How Booster Boxes and Card Packs Work
Players buy Card Packs using Gems and open them through Booster Boxes. Packs can be opened one at a time or in batches of ten. Each pack reveals five cards in a single opening.
Every pack has a 95% chance to reveal Champion Cards and a 5% chance to reveal Scheme Cards. The selected pack affects possible rarity outcomes. Once the opening finishes, the cards mint as NFTs.
All minted cards are sent to the account’s primary wallet. This setup keeps ownership simple and avoids future confusion.

Rerolls Add Strategy to Booster Box Openings
Each Card Pack opened from a Booster Box includes the option to reroll the entire pack. A reroll replaces all five cards with a fresh result. Players can use up to five rerolls per pack.
Rerolls require Gems and must be used before confirming the pack. Once confirmed, the results are final and minted immediately. Rerolls give players control without removing randomness.
Gems Power the Booster Box Economy
Gems function as the in-game currency for Booster Box purchases and rerolls. Players can buy Gems using Ronin, Ethereum, Base, or Abstract. The process happens directly through the game.
Gems are non-transferable and tied to the account. All linked wallets share the same Gem balance. Any linked wallet can spend Gems freely.

Wallet Setup and Account Rules
Grand Arena uses an account-based wallet system instead of a single-wallet model. The first wallet used becomes the primary wallet. All Booster Box rewards mint to that wallet.
Players can link multiple wallets to one account. Linked wallets share cards, Gems, and progression. Wallets cannot be unlinked once added. Logging in with a new wallet creates a new account.

Viewing, Trading, and Managing Cards
All cards opened from a Booster Box appear in the Cards tab. This section acts as the main collection hub. Players can view and manage everything from one place. Grand Arena cards are now tradeable on Ronin Marketplace. Players can buy and sell cards freely, allowing real price discovery. Trading adds flexibility for collectors and competitive players.
Cards can also be filtered by Champion, Scheme, rarity, or favorites. Selecting a card displays its stats and upgrade options.

Crafting Upgrades Cards Over Time
Crafting lets players convert duplicate cards into higher rarity versions. This system rewards steady Booster Box openings and long-term play. Crafting does not cost Gems.
Three Basic cards combine into one Rare. Ten Rare cards convert into one Epic. Eight Epic cards combine into one Legendary. Crafting helps smooth out unlucky openings over time.
Booster Box Openings and mXP Progression
Opening Card Packs from a Booster Box grants mXP. mXP represents overall progression inside Grand Arena and affects Season 1 rewards. Every pack opened adds to that total.
Players can track mXP inside the account dashboard. The dashboard shows current balance, estimated earnings, and activity history. For now, pack openings remain the primary mXP source.

Booster Box Market Activity and Floor Price
Interest in Booster Boxes continues to grow as openings remain active. The Booster Box floor price has steadily increased and is now approaching 600 RON per Booster Box. It also recorded a daily trading volume exceeding 146,000 RON, equivalent to over $20,000 USD, highlighting strong and sustained market demand.
This upward movement reflects strong demand from players and collectors. With cards now tradeable and mXP already live, Booster Boxes have become a central asset in the Grand Arena economy. Mokis and Grand Arena NFTs currently account for three of the top five most-traded NFTs on Ronin, underscoring their growing market traction and investor interest.
